The History of Patola

Patola weaving is believed to date back to the 11th century, rooted in the town of Patan in Gujarat. It was once considered a luxury fabric, worn by royalty and the aristocracy in India and abroad. The technique used to create Patola is known as double ikat, where both the warp and weft threads are tie-dyed meticulously before weaving, resulting in designs that are identical on both sides of the fabric. This labor-intensive process can take anywhere from six months to a year to produce a single piece, making it a symbol of wealth and status.

Style of Designs

The motifs in Patola prints are deeply symbolic, often inspired by the natural world, including elephants, flowers, parrots, and dancing figures. These designs are not just decorative but carry meanings and wishes for prosperity, health, and protection. The geometric precision and vivid color palette make Patola prints timeless, appealing to both traditional and contemporary tastes.

Uses of Patola

While originally used in saris and ceremonial wear, the versatility of Patola has seen its adaptation into a wide range of garments and home decor. From elegant dresses to striking wall hangings, the distinct pattern of Patola adds a touch of sophistication and cultural richness to any item it graces.
